A resolution designating July 2025 as "Plastic Pollution Action Month".
SRES 320 is a non-binding Senate resolution designating July 2025 as "Plastic Pollution Action Month." It does not create new laws or funding but formally recognizes the environmental and health impacts of plastic pollution through cited statistics (e.g., 171 trillion plastic pieces in oceans, 1.5 million microplastics ingested daily by humans). The resolution encourages all U.S. individuals to participate in reducing plastic pollution during July 2025 and year-round through reusable alternatives and waste reduction. As a procedural resolution, it has no legal effect but aims to raise public awareness and support ongoing cleanup efforts.
